区块链技术的出现,深刻改变了传统的金融体系。作为连接用户与区块链网络的桥梁,区块链扮演着至关重要的角色。在当前数字资产投资热潮的推动下,区块链的开发与需求亟待深入分析。本文旨在通过对区块链的需求进行全面分析,帮助开发者和企业了解市场脉搏,制定合适的开发策略。
## 第一部分:区块链的定义与分类 ### 什么是区块链区块链是指存储公钥和私钥等信息的软件或硬件。用户通过这些可以管理自己的数字资产,包括比特币、以太坊等各种加密货币。的本质是保证用户数字资产的安全,提供易用的操作界面,帮助用户便捷地进行数字资产交易。
### 常见的区块链分类区块链主要分为热和冷。热是指一直连接互联网的,便于交易但相对安全性差;而冷则是离线存储,安全性更高,适合长期保存数字资产。
### 各类的特点与适用场景热,其灵活性和便捷性使其成为日常交易的首选。然而,其频繁连接互联网使其面临更大的安全风险。相比之下,冷虽然不适合频繁交易,但其强大的安全性使其成为长期投资者的理想选择。
## 第二部分:区块链的市场需求分析 ### 当前市场环境随着数字货币市值的快速增长,市场对区块链的需求激增。越来越多的人希望能够安全、便捷地管理自己的数字资产,促进了市场的蓬勃发展。
### 用户对区块链的需求趋势当前用户对区块链的需求主要集中在安全性、易用性和支持多种数字资产等方面。此外,越来越多的用户希望能够通过进行更多的金融活动,如借贷、质押等。
### 目标用户群体分析目标用户群体包括个人投资者、机构投资者及传统金融机构。个人投资者要求简单易用的界面,机构投资者则对安全性和合规性有更高的要求。
## 第三部分:区块链开发的关键需求 ### 安全性需求安全性是区块链开发中最为关键的因素。开发者需要实现多层次的安全措施,如双重验证、加密技术和冷存储等,确保用户的数字资产不会被盗用。
### 用户体验需求用户体验的好坏直接关系到的使用率。开发者需要关注的界面设计、操作流畅性以及用户的学习成本,努力提升用户的使用体验。
### 兼容性需求需要支持多种数字货币,并具备良好的兼容性。用户希望能够在一个中管理所有的数字资产,而不是为不同的币种使用多个。
### 功能需求除了基本的存储和交易功能,现代区块链还需要引入更多的功能,比如资产管理、投资分析和定期报告等,以满足用户多样化的需求。
## 第四部分:区块链开发的技术需求 ### 技术架构设计技术架构需要具备良好的扩展性和灵活性。采用微服务架构或区块链服务架构,可以让开发团队在后期进行更好的维护及升级。
### 区块链网络选择在的开发中,选择公链或联盟链都会影响到的性能和功能。不同的区块链网络适合不同的应用场景,开发者需要根据项目需求进行选择。
### 数据存储方案数据存储是区块链开发中的重要一环,需要考虑数据的安全性、可扩展性和查询效率。选择合适的数据库系统,是提高系统稳定性的关键。
### API与第三方服务的集成随着区块链技术的不断发展,集成第三方服务,如去中心化交易所、市场数据提供者等,可以提升的功能和用户体验。
## 第五部分:区块链开发的法律与合规性分析 ### 地区法规及其对开发的影响不同地区对区块链的监管政策有所不同,如一些国家对数字货币采取了非常严格的法规。必须在开发过程中关注这些法律法规,以避免潜在的法律风险。
### 合规性的必要性与实施合规性不仅涉及到法律法规的遵循,还包括用户信息保障和安全性审计。开发者在设计时,必须实施相应的合规措施,以保障用户的合法权益。
## 第六部分:未来区块链的发展趋势与挑战 ### 行业趋势分析未来,区块链将不仅仅是数字资产的存储工具,更将转型为集成金融服务的平台,提供借贷、交易等一系列功能。同时,随着DeFi和NFT等新兴技术的发展,区块链的功能将更加多样化。
### 面临的主要挑战与应对策略未来面对的挑战主要包括技术更新迅速、法律合规压力加大以及用户需求多样化等。开发者需不断学习和适应新技术,灵活应对这些变化。
## 结论区块链的开发需求分析,是一个复杂且重要的过程。安全性、用户体验、技术架构等多方面的因素都需被认真考虑。只有根据市场需求不断迭代,才能够在竞争激烈的市场中立于不败之地。在未来的发展中,我们期待区块链能够实现更好的用户服务与技术创新。
--- ## 相关问题及详细介绍 ### 区块链的安全性如何保障?区块链的安全性是用户最为关心的问题之一。保障安全性的方法多种多样,包括身份验证、数据加密、冷存储等技术措施。
通过引入多重身份验证,用户在访问时需要通过多步骤确认身份,这样即使有人获得了用户的密码,也无法轻易访问。
对用户的敏感信息和存储的数字资产进行加密处理,可以有效防止数据泄露或被非法获取。采用业界标准的加密协议,如AES等,能够增强数据保护的能力。
将绝大部分资金储存在离线环境中,即使热遭到攻击,冷的安全性依旧可以保护用户的资产安全。冷存储相对不便于频繁交易,但在保护长期投资者的资产安全方面,十分有效。
定期对系统进行安全审计,以发现可能的漏洞。通过专业的第三方安全公司进行代码审查,能有效提升的安全性能。
对用户进行安全意识培训,教导用户如何正确使用,避免钓鱼攻击等常见网络威胁,是提升整体安全性的重要一环。
### 如何提升区块链的用户体验?用户体验是决定产品成败的重要因素。在数字领域,简洁、直观的操作界面能够使用户更快的上手和使用,从而提升用户满意度。
采用现代化、简洁的UI设计,帮助用户迅速找到所需功能。通过合理的布局和清晰的指引,使得即使是初学者也能轻松上手。
的后台系统,确保用户在进行转账、查看资产时能够快速反应,避免出现卡顿、延迟等现象,保持良好的用户体验。
建立有效的用户反馈机制,鼓励用户反馈使用过程中的问题和建议。这不仅能帮助改进产品,还能使用户感受到被重视,提升忠诚度。
提供丰富的使用文档和视频教程,为用户解决常见问题提供帮助。此外,建立在线客服渠道,与用户保持良好的沟通,增强用户的信任感。
根据用户反馈,定期进行产品和功能更新。快速响应用户的需求变化,在竞争中保持舒适的用户体验。
### 区块链的兼容性有哪些影响因素?的兼容性直接关系到用户的使用体验以及的吸引力。一个能够支持多种数字资产的,往往更能满足广大用户的需求。
随着区块链项目的不断增多,用户对数字资产的需求也越来越多样化。必须具备支持各种主流及新兴币种的能力,以适应快速变化的市场环境。
通过API和其他第三方服务进行集成,能够极大提升的功能。用户希望在一个中进行多项操作,而不仅局限于存储和交易,提升了的实用性。
确保能在多个平台上使用(如iOS、Android、Web等),让用户在不同设备上都能方便地访问自己的数字资产,增强了产品的灵活性和可接触性。
开发团队需保持对当前区块链技术的关注,并根据技术的快速变化,不断更新和升级系统,以确保其兼容性并能够满足新的用户需求。
提供针对不同币种或平台的使用支持,确保用户在遇到兼容性问题时,能够方便地获得帮助,减少用户流失。
### 区块链的功能如何设计?现代区块链需要具备多项功能,以满足用户的多元化需求。除了基本的资产管理功能,还应提供更多便捷服务。
最基本的功能是支持多种数字资产的存储和交易。用户需要简洁的操作流程,以便快速完成买卖交易。
用户希望能够看到自己资产的整体情况,以及市场表现等。提供清晰的投资组合展示,并设计分析工具,可以帮助用户更好地管理资产。
集成DeFi功能,如借贷、流动性挖掘等,可以满足用户更多创新的金融需求。提升的吸引力。
对于一些多币种的用户,应提供方便快捷的代币管理工具,允许用户在不同代币间快捷转换,提高使用的灵活性。
通过API集成最新的市场信息和行情数据,让用户随时了解市场动态,以便于用户做出更好的投资决策。
### 如何确保区块链的法律与合规性?法律合规性是区块链开发过程中不可或缺的一部分。随着各国对区块链行业监管政策的逐步完善,合规性愈发重要。
不同国家对数字资产的法律法规有所不同,开发团队需详细研究目标市场所在地区的法律政策,确保项目疼痛合法合规。
通过KYC(了解你的客户)和AML(反洗钱)等流程,确保用户身份的真实性,并防止非法资金的流入,保护用户资产以及品牌声誉。
合理处理用户的个人信息,遵循GDPR等数据保护法规,在保证用户隐私的同时,也确保的正常运营。
在开发过程中引入法律顾问,确保在每个阶段都考虑到法律合规性问题,避免潜在的法律风险。
进行定期的安全审计和合规性检查,以确保产品和平台持续符合相关法律法规。同时,保持透明度,向用户及时披露合规状态。
### 未来区块链的发展趋势和挑战是什么?随着区块链技术的不断发展,将逐步向综合性金融服务平台转型,提供借贷、交易、资产管理等多功能服务,满足用户日益增长的需求。
如NFT市场、DeFi功能的集成,能够提升的市场竞争力。提供用户更广阔的线上金融服务选择。
随着技术的快速更新迭代,需要定期进行技术升级,以保持用户的使用体验和数据安全性。
全球监管政策的变化将影响的运营,开发者需敏锐捕捉这些变化,灵活调整业务模型,保持合规性。
用户对数字货币的认知程度各异,提高用户的教育和引导,帮助用户更好地理解的使用及其潜在风险至关重要。
随着越来越多公司进入区块链领域,竞争加剧,加大了市场饱和的风险,开发团队需要持续创新,才能脱颖而出。
通过这份详细的需求分析及相关问题的探讨,能够让区块链的开发者更深入地理解市场需求,进行有针对性的产品设计和技术开发。这不仅能提高产品的市场适应性,也将为用户创造更大的价值。